
Crypto.com Launches Institutional Custody Service in the United States
Update (Dec. 24, 8:30 am UTC)
This article has been updated to include a clarification from Crypto.com that while its exchange is still not live in the US, the Crypto.com app never was suspended.

Crypto.com has launched an institutional cryptocurrency custody service in the United States as part of a broader plan to expand its presence in the country. Launch of Crypto.com Custody Trust Company
The chartered trust, dubbed Crypto.com Custody Trust Company, is eligible to custody assets for US institutions and high-net-worth individuals. Digital Assets Migration
As part of this launch, digital assets held by Crypto.com’s US and Canadian customers will migrate to Crypto.com Custody Trust Company over the coming weeks. Quotes from Kris Marszalek
According to Kris Marszalek, CEO of Crypto.com, "This step reflects our confidence in the North American market." He further emphasized that this development advances Crypto.com’s roadmap for building its business and presence in two of the most important and active crypto markets in the world — the US and Canada.
Related Developments
In related news, US President-elect Donald Trump met with Marszalek at Trump’s home in Mar-a-Lago to discuss crypto policies. The same day, Crypto.com dropped its lawsuit against the US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C), citing its intent to work with the incoming administration on a regulatory framework for the industry.
Regulatory Framework
Trump has expressed his desire for the US to become "the world’s crypto capital" and is tapping pro-industry leaders to head key regulatory agencies when he starts his presidential term in January. Background on Crypto.com
Crypto.com is headquartered in Singapore and launched in the US in 2022, initially only for institutional investors. Although the exchange is still not live in the US, the app was never suspended in the jurisdiction. The company’s expansion plans were further solidified with its acquisition of Watchdog Capital, a broker-dealer registered with the SEC, in October.
Regulated Custodians
Regulated digital asset custodians are proliferating in the US. In September, BitGo launched a regulated platform designed to custody and manage native tokens for Web3 protocols. Other institutional crypto companies, including Coinbase Custody Trust, Fidelity Digital Asset Services, and Anchorage Digital NY, have also obtained similar licenses.
